Overcoming Regional Blocks for Cross-Border Access</strong></p><p>Many websites restrict access based on the visitor’s IP location, limiting data visibility from certain regions. With IP proxies, companies can switch to IPs from different countries, enabling seamless access to localized content. For instance, during price monitoring or market analysis, businesses can directly collect region-specific data, ensuring accuracy and authenticity.</p><p><br></p><p><strong>2. Distributed Nodes for Greater Stability</strong></p><p>Premium proxy networks operate global node infrastructures that support large-scale concurrent requests. Through distributed crawling, systems can rotate between multiple IPs across countries, minimizing detection and blocking risks. This ensures continuous data collection with high success rates and stable performance.</p><p><br></p><p><strong>3. Enhanced Anonymity and Security</strong></p><p>Using a proxy server effectively hides the company’s real IP address, preventing tracking or blacklisting by target sites. Some proxy providers also offer encrypted data transmission, which protects information from interception or tampering during collection—making the process safer and more reliable.</p><p><br></p><p><strong>4. Automation and Smart IP Management</strong></p><p>Modern proxy services go beyond manual IP switching, offering intelligent API management systems. These can automatically allocate IPs based on region, request frequency, or task priority. For continuous data crawling, ad verification, or market research, such automation greatly improves efficiency while reducing manual maintenance costs.</p><p><br></p><p><strong>5.
